Web with a stick or pencil gauge, just push the gauge down on the valve stem and the measuring stick inside will move out from the device. Most standard pressure regulators have a maximum adjustment of up to 75 psi. Note that psig is always lower than psia. On the stick, you’ll see psi readings, and the line where the stick stops is the corresponding pressure inside the tire.
